Amniotic Band Syndrome, also known as Streeter Dysplasia, is a complex condition arising from the entrapment of fetal parts in fibrous strands of amniotic tissue, which can lead to a spectrum of congenital malformations. This syndrome is characterized by a variety of limb and facial deformities because the bands can constrict or sever the developing regions of the fetus. The origins of Amniotic Band Syndrome are not fully understood, but it is believed to occur during the early stages of pregnancy, particularly between the sixth and eighteenth weeks of gestation. As the fetus grows, the amniotic bands may form due to the rupture of the amniotic sac or due to abnormal amniotic fluid dynamics, leading to the formation of fibrous tissue that can wrap around the limbs, digits, and even craniofacial structures. The severity of the condition can vary significantly; in some cases, affected individuals may have only minor deformities, while in others, they may experience major complications, such as limb loss or severe malformation of facial features. The condition is believed to occur sporadically rather than as a result of genetic inheritance, and it can be associated with other intrauterine factors, such as oligohydramnios (low amniotic fluid levels) that can increase the risk of constriction. The presentation of Amniotic Band Syndrome can include a wide range of manifestations, including limb anomalies such as clubfoot, webbed fingers, and missing digits, as well as constriction rings which may lead to amputations or severe functional limitations. In addition to limb malformations, the syndrome can also present with facial deformities such as cleft lip or palate, as well as cranial anomalies. Diagnosis is typically made through prenatal imaging techniques like ultrasound, which can reveal the presence of constriction bands and any associated limb or facial malformations. After birth, management of Amniotic Band Syndrome often involves a multi-disciplinary approach, including orthopedic, plastic, and reconstructive surgeries, physical therapy, and supportive care to optimize the patient's functional outcome. The prognosis can vary widely depending on the severity of the malformations and the potential for functional recovery following surgical and therapeutic interventions. Overall, while Amniotic Band Syndrome presents significant challenges both in terms of physical health and the psychological impact on affected individuals and their families, advancements in surgical techniques and rehabilitative services have gradually improved outcomes for many. Recognizing and understanding the complexities of this syndrome is critical for healthcare providers in order to facilitate proper care and support for those affected.
